Brackish Water RO Membranes Specifications:
- Nominal Size: 2.5" x 40"
- Certification: NSF 61 certified
- Salt Rejection Rate: 99.5%
- Average Permeate ±15%: 750 GPD @ 225 PSI
- Feedwater NaCl: 2,000 ppm
- Fresh Water Recovery Rate: 8%
- Feed Spacer: 28 mm
- Maximum Recommended NaCl: <10,000 ppm
- Maximum Operating Pressure 600 PSI

What does 99.5% salt rejection mean?
A 99.5% salt rejection rate means the membrane blocks 99.5% of dissolved salts and similar contaminants from passing through, based on standardized lab testing against 2,000 ppm feedwater NaCl. Real-world rejection of brackish water RO membranes can vary with feed water quality and system conditions.
Is the SP-BW2540 suitable for seawater desalination?
No. The SP-BW2540 is rated for brackish water up to 10,000 ppm NaCl maximum, far below seawater's typical salinity. For seawater desalination, choose the SpiroPure SP-SW2540, engineered for up to 40,000 ppm NaCl at higher operating pressure.
